Antimatter and Pseudotachyonic Relativity

Description

A new conception of antiparticle is proposed as the subluminal '' image '' of a tachyonic homologous particle. After a first article on the subject, we begin by studying the pseudotachyonic transformation for energy, linear momentum and mass. We'll finally conclude that: · antiparticles must have negative energy (and massive ones also negative masses) and opposite electric charge; · antiphotons behave differently from photons; · this difference appears, for instance, in the Compton effect generalized to antiparticles; · the annihilation of colliding homologous particles and pair creation through colliding particles (this one yet an open problem) doesn't exactly fit in its standard description; · antimatter is characterized by negative absolute temperatures and the inversion of the 2nd law of Thermodynamics.
